Hello.
I am planning to get a new laptop next week.
The one I have in mind has a GTX 1050 graphics card and i7 7700HQ processor.
I just want one to game on 1080p, medium settings. So GTX 1050 will be enough for me, I guess.
But a guy told me that the GPU/CPU combo is too lopsided. The CPU is too powerful and I wont need it.
And its true I guess.
What CPU do I need for gaming and occasional 3D renders on softwares like Maya and Blender?
Thank you!

At 1080p, yes you'll be fine on a notebook gaming scene. You're going to benefit with more ram and the CPU if you're going to render on Blender and Maya. Will you be working on Skecthup and AutoCAD as well? If so the i7 will punch through.

Laptop parts are not as powerfull as desktop ones, you know for heat and power limits, now saying the i7 is too powerfull is not quite right, for games you probably wont use that many threads and cores (usually) but the clock speed is not that high to call it overkill (honestly theres nothing too powerfull maybe just expensive), now the GPU is not as strong as you would like for running games at 1080p in high or ultra settings. for 3D rendering, maya and blender it is good and you´ll benefit more whith 16Gb + RAM.
